Actually, my main point is to highlight some details. I really appreciate the rule of the same color for every player during a match. For me, it's much better to follow games since I watch them on TV from a bit far distance.
Second, the new userpatch feature for holding shift and clicking a unit or building to change the selected player while watching has made things more practical for the streamers, I saw Memb using the feature quite a lot. By the way, props to him for uploading the videos so fast to youtube.
